The significance of effective shade removal
From textiles and dyes to paper and pulp industries, numerous sectors create wastewater containing vivid hues that can be destructive to the surroundings if still left untreated. These shades are often the results of artificial dyes, pure pigments, or other chemical compounds current from the wastewater. Moreover remaining aesthetically uncomfortable, colored wastewater can block sunlight penetration in water bodies, disrupting the pure stability of aquatic ecosystems and hindering the growth of vegetation and organisms.
Furthermore, some coloured compounds can be poisonous or carcinogenic, posing a menace to human well being. Thus, efficient colour elimination is very important not only for preserving the aesthetic excellent of h2o but additionally for preserving the atmosphere and safeguarding general public health.
The science at the rear of colour in squander water
To understand how coloration removing will work, it is critical to grasp the underlying science behind the existence of colour in wastewater. Color is generally because of the presence of chromophores, that happen to be chemical teams chargeable for absorbing light at specific wavelengths. These chromophores can be organic or inorganic in mother nature, depending upon the supply of the coloration.
Natural and organic chromophores, like those located in dyes and pigments, are generally used in a variety of industries and they are noted for their lively and persistent colors. Inorganic chromophores, on the other hand, are typically derived from hefty metals, like iron or manganese, and can give wastewater a definite metallic hue.
The absorption of light by these chromophores generates color inside the h2o. The wavelength of light absorbed establishes the observed color. Such as, if a compound absorbs gentle during the blue area with the spectrum, it can surface yellow in colour.
Prevalent strategies for coloration removing
Coloration removing from wastewater could be accomplished through several methods, Just about every with its own positive aspects and constraints. These techniques is usually broadly categorized into biological cure, chemical therapy, and Bodily treatment method processes.
Organic remedy for color removing
Organic cure procedures make the most of Normally developing microorganisms to degrade or renovate the chromophores existing in wastewater. One of the most generally utilized Organic cure approaches is activated sludge cure. This method entails providing an oxygen-abundant surroundings for microorganisms to stop working organic compounds, together with chromophores.
For the duration of activated sludge procedure, wastewater is mixed by using a suspension of microorganisms inside of a tank. The microorganisms metabolize the natural make any difference within the wastewater, such as the chromophores, changing them into more simple, colorless compounds. This method efficiently cuts down the colour of your wastewater.
An additional biological treatment approach is the use of algae and aquatic plants. These organisms can absorb and metabolize specified chromophores, proficiently eradicating them within the drinking water. Additionally, the photosynthetic exercise of algae and vegetation also can help in oxygenating the h2o, advertising the growth of beneficial microbes, and aiding in the general purification approach.
Chemical therapy for coloration elimination
Chemical therapy techniques involve the addition of substances on the wastewater to aid color elimination. 1 prevalent chemical used for this reason is coagulants, like aluminum sulfate or ferric chloride. These chemicals destabilize the colored particles from the water, producing them to clump jointly and settle down as sediment. This sediment can then be divided from the drinking water by filtration or sedimentation procedures.
A different chemical therapy process is the use of oxidizing agents, for example chlorine or hydrogen peroxide. These brokers react Using the chromophores, breaking them down into smaller, colorless compounds. Nevertheless, it is necessary to thoroughly Management the dosage of such chemical compounds to stay away from the development of dangerous byproducts or the release of extreme chlorine in the environment.
Actual physical cure for colour removal
Bodily therapy methods count on physical processes to get rid of color from wastewater. A person widespread Actual physical treatment method is adsorption, the place a fabric that has a high affinity to the chromophores is utilised to eliminate them in the water. Activated carbon is commonly utilized as an adsorbent because of its huge surface area spot and ability to efficiently adsorb an array of compounds, like colour-leading to chromophores.
Membrane filtration is another Actual physical procedure process employed for color removing. This process involves passing the wastewater via a membrane with little pores, letting the water molecules to pass through while retaining the more substantial coloured particles. This process can successfully remove coloration and also other impurities from the wastewater.
Variables influencing the efficiency of colour elimination
The performance of color removal solutions might be motivated by a variety of components, such as the sort and concentration of the color-creating compounds, the pH in the wastewater, the presence of other contaminants, plus the properties with the treatment method by itself.
The kind and concentration of the color-leading to compounds Engage in a major function in identifying the success of coloration elimination approaches. Some compounds can be a lot more resistant to degradation or adsorption, demanding additional specialized cure strategies. In addition, increased concentrations of coloration-creating compounds can overwhelm the procedure approach, lessening its effectiveness.
The pH of the wastewater may influence coloration removing. Some color removal approaches are more practical at particular pH ranges. Altering the pH of the wastewater for the best array for a selected procedure system can increase its effectiveness.
The presence of other contaminants while in the wastewater, such as organic and natural subject or significant metals, may also impression coloration elimination. These contaminants could interfere With all the remedy procedure or have to have further therapy steps to effectively take out them.
And finally, the traits of the treatment course of action itself, like the Call time amongst the wastewater as well as therapy agent, the temperature, along with the presence of oxygen, can influence the efficiency of coloration removing. Optimizing these parameters can Enhance the In general usefulness with the procedure course of action.
Innovations in color removal systems
With the escalating demand from customers for efficient and sustainable shade removal solutions, researchers and engineers are consistently building innovative technologies to deal with The difficulty. One particular these kinds of innovation is the use of advanced oxidation processes (AOPs). AOPs contain the era of really reactive hydroxyl radicals, that may correctly stop working and degrade colour-creating compounds. These radicals are generated via numerous techniques, such as the utilization of ultraviolet (UV) light-weight, ozone, or photocatalysts.
One more rising engineering is the usage of nanomaterials for shade removing. Nanomaterials, such as nanoparticles or nanocomposites, give unique Qualities which can boost the performance of shade removal procedures. These elements may have a higher area place, letting for enhanced adsorption of color-creating compounds, or show catalytic properties that endorse the degradation of chromophores.
On top of that, the integration of biological and Bodily treatment procedures is getting traction in the field of coloration removal. By combining the strengths of equally methods, researchers are developing hybrid programs which can proficiently get rid of coloration though minimizing Power usage and chemical usage.
